    I find zumba a great way to start - either in a live class or at home. It can be a little overwhelming at first but you quickly catch on to the choreography after a few classes and then you can just let loose and move. I'm not a dancer by any stretch of the imagination either, but I always feel like one in my zumba classes. Hahaha. Another thing that I really love is going to a hula hooping class. Everything is done to music and dancing but you are concentrating so much on keeping the hula hoop from falling (at least at first) that you don't feel silly about the dance moves themselves. For me, it's all about having fun.

    I do my classes at a gym so I don't have any suggestions for specific dvds, but there are lots out there. You should be able to find some that are geared towards beginners and work from there. Enjoy :)
